Needle Award
Morning Glory's Long Lost Order of Worship received The Needle Award in the literary fiction
category. Girl on Demand, creator of The Needle, reviewed 50 books in 2005 on her blog (out of 1,400
books considered and 6,000 queries), then selected a total of 10 nominees (five in the literary
category and five in the commercial category). The award was judged by a panel of literary agents and
editors.

The 2008 InnermoonLit Contest for Best First Chapter of a Novel
Congratulations to this year's winners, culled from a truly impressive batch of 198 entries: Melissa
Yuan-Innes, Erika Swyler, and Kate Beswick. Click here for more details.
2007 InnermoonLit Short-Short Story Contest results
Laura Loomis, of the San Francisco area, has won first prize! Second place went to Steve Nelson and
third to Mab Ryan, both of whom, coincidentally enough, live in Wisconsin. Congratulations to our
winners, and thanks to all 197 entrants. Click here for more information about the winning entries
